Data Mode

The TA enters data mode when it makes a successful data communications

link with a remote device. In data mode, the TA can send and receive data,

but it does not respond to AT commands. Instead, it treats them as data, and

transmits them to the remote device.

Online Command Mode

In online command mode, the TA responds to AT commands while

maintaining a data communications link; however, transmission of data is

suspended. To enter online command mode from data mode, type the escape

sequence +++AT<cr>. To return to data mode from online command mode,

type ATO<cr>.

Making a Call

Before you can place a data call, you must configure the TA for the local

switch type, serial port speed, and the data type of the ISDN device you

want to call.

Dialing

To dial a number using AT commands, you must first start a data

communications program. In the program’s terminal mode, type

ATDxxxxxxx<cr>, where xxxxxxx is the telephone number you want to

dial, and <cr> is the carriage return character that is sent when you press

ENTER , e.g, ATD7853500<cr>. The dial string can contain up to 80

characters.
To make it easier to read the dial string, you can use hyphens, spaces or

parentheses. These characters are ignored by the TA. For example, the TA

would read the following dial strings the same way:

ATD16127853500 <cr>

ATD 1-612-785-3500 <cr>

ATD 1 (612) 785-3500 <cr>
